Property Crime in Craftsbury, VT

Our analysis gives Craftsbury a property crime grade of: A. Craftsbury is in the 10th percentile of safety, meaning 10% of cities in Vermont are safer and 90% are more dangerous. Please visit our Craftsbury crime map for details on how this is calculated and what it means.

So, is Craftsbury safe? Compared to all of Vermont, Craftsbury is rated as safe as the average Vermont city, which has a property crime rate of 13.29 per 1000. Looking at burglary, we see a similar pattern, where Craftsbury, with its burglary rate of 2.569 per 1000, is as safe as the average Vermont city.

In addition, Craftsbury is lower than other cities with similar populations for property crime. The table below shows property crime rates and level of occurrence in Craftsbury, VT.

Police Stations Near Craftsbury, VT

There are 0 police stations within the boundaries of Craftsbury, and 0 within 5 miles. Within 50 miles of the Craftsbury center, there are 104 police stations. Compared to other cities, police response times in Craftsbury may be much slower. When response times are less than ideal, every second your security system saves in reporting a crime will improve the police response.
